About This Item

London.: B. T. Batsford Ltd., 1912. xxii, 493pp, illustrated by over 220 reproductions from photographs and a series of ground plans to a uniform scale. Original blue cloth with gilt titles & decoration. Clean & bright covers. Internally unmarked. . Hardcover. Very Good+.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all.
